Course Introduction

This Managing Project Stakeholders training course will help you to cultivate your skills and knowledge of stakeholders. It includes the processes required to identify the people, groups or organisations that could impact or be impacted by a project, before moving on to analyze stakeholder expectations and develop appropriate management strategies for engaging stakeholders.

Do you properly involve stakeholders on your projects? Have you ever had a key stakeholder complain they don’t know what is going on? Have you delivered products into the business only to find users don’t like the new system or worse don’t even use it? Projects will not be successful without regular continuous close contact interactions with all the stakeholders. This training course will provide you with a traditional stakeholder management process but will also go further by examining communications management, project leadership, governance, and change management.

Course Outline

Day One

Stakeholder Identification

  • Project basics
  • Stakeholder definition
  • Stakeholder identification techniques
  • Project Governance
  • Internal & external stakeholders
  • Project leadership
Day Two

Stakeholder Analysis

  • Power, interest and influence
  • Stakeholder salience 
  • Stakeholder mapping
  • Setting expectations using the Project Mission
  • Public relations
  • The art of active listening
  • Determining requirements
Day Three

Plan your Stakeholder Tactics

  • Planning Stakeholder Management
  • Change Management
  • Traditional vs iterative project management
  • Lean project management
  • Project branding
  • Negotiation and delegation
Day Four

Stakeholder Communication

  • Importance of verbal, vocal and visual communication
  • Assertive communication to control situations
  • Giving and receiving criticism 
  • Resolving conflicts constructively
  • Risk management
Day Five

Manage and Control Stakeholder Engagement

  • Project control - How are you?
  • Earned Value Management
  • Change and Issue logs
  • Benefits Plan
  • Post Project Review
  • Celebrate milestones and success with stakeholders
